Abstract

Antifungal nail coat compositions containing an allylamine, an N,N-di(C 1 -C 8 ) alkylamino substituted, (C 4 -C 18 ) alkyl (C 2 -C 18 ) carboxylic ester or a p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salt thereof, a hydrophilic polymer, and a pharmaceutically acceptable, volatile organic carrier are disclosed. The composition provides a substantially water-soluble, fungicidal coating upon contact with a fungally susceptible or infected nail.

         23 . A method for ameliorating or preventing fungal infection of a toenail or fingernail comprising contacting a fungally susceptible or infected nail and skin tissue adjacent thereto with a nail coat composition consisting essentially of, on a total composition weight basis:
 about 0.5 to about 10 weight percent terbinafine hydrochloride:   about 0.1 to about 25 weight percent dodecyl-2-(N,N-dimethylamino) isopropionate hydrochloride:   about 0.1 to about 10 weight perecent benzyl alcohol;   about 0.1 to about 5 weight percent polyvinylpyrrolidone; and   the remainder ethanol.   
     
     
         24 . The method according to  claim 23  wherein the contact is maintained for a period of at least about 0.5 hours. 
     
     
         25 . The method according to  claim 23  wherein the method is performed at least once a day. 
     
     
         26 . The method according to  claim 24  wherein the method is performed at least once a day. 
     
     
         27 . The method according to  claim 23 , wherein the method is practiced daily until new nail growth is free of fungal infection. 
     
     
         28 . The method according to  claim 24 , wherein the method is practiced daily until new nail growth is free of fungal infection. 
     
     
         29 . The method according to  claim 23 , wherein the composition is applied by brushing or spraying. 
     
     
         30 . The method according to  claim 23 , wherein the nail coat composition consists essentially of, on a total composition weight basis:
 about 10 weight percent terbinafine hydrochloride:   about 0.5 weight percent dodecyl-2-(N,N-dimethylamino) isopropionate hydrochloride:   about 0.75 weight perecent benzyl alcohol;   about 0.5 weight percent polyvinylpyrrolidone; and   the remainder ethanol.
